Output 93f012d6c7df30368f1b5b09aea3abe53ebfd84d0993980360881d4f16a4fb65:3347

value
532529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 134e71a038737f9611c0fe90de6fac58123a3390 OP_EQUAL
address
33T6jZbgsnc6mBM7o9DfYjoV1xnRnJ8dZg
transaction
93f012d6c7df30368f1b5b09aea3abe53ebfd84d0993980360881d4f16a4fb65
confirmations
322780
spent
true